How to Choose the Best Nerve Pain Supplement
The most effective nerve pain supplements typically include alpha-lipoic acid (600mg daily), B vitamins (especially methylcobalamin B12 and benfotiamine/B1), magnesium glycinate, and acetyl-L-carnitine. Alpha-lipoic acid is the most well-studied ingredient for neuropathy, with multiple clinical trials supporting its use at 600mg daily for diabetic neuropathy. B12 in the methylcobalamin form is essential for myelin sheath maintenance and nerve repair.
Identifying the root cause of nerve pain can help guide your supplement selection. B12 deficiency neuropathy responds well to high-dose methylcobalamin. Diabetic neuropathy has the strongest evidence for alpha-lipoic acid. Inflammatory nerve pain (sciatica, pinched nerves) may benefit more from anti-inflammatory formulas with turmeric and boswellia. Magnesium deficiency should be addressed with glycinate or citrate forms.
Look for products that use bioavailable ingredient forms: methylcobalamin (not cyanocobalamin) for B12, benfotiamine (not standard thiamine) for B1, magnesium glycinate (not oxide) for magnesium, and R-alpha-lipoic acid when possible. These forms are better absorbed and more effective than their cheaper alternatives.
Third-party testing and GMP certification are important quality markers. Nerve supplements are often used long-term, so look for products that offer good per-serving value over a 30-90 day supply. Most nerve supplements take 2-8 weeks to show noticeable improvements in symptoms.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the best supplement for nerve pain?
Alpha-lipoic acid (ALA) at 600mg daily has the strongest clinical evidence for nerve pain, particularly diabetic neuropathy. Methylcobalamin B12 is essential for nerve repair, and magnesium glycinate supports nerve signaling. A comprehensive neuropathy formula combining ALA, B vitamins, and acetyl-L-carnitine provides the broadest support.
How long do nerve supplements take to work?
Most people notice some improvement in tingling and numbness within 2-4 weeks, with more significant pain reduction developing over 6-12 weeks of consistent use. B12 supplementation may show quicker results if a deficiency is present, while alpha-lipoic acid typically reaches full effectiveness around 4-8 weeks.
Can supplements help with diabetic neuropathy?
Yes. Alpha-lipoic acid at 600mg daily has been shown in multiple clinical trials to reduce neuropathic pain, burning, and numbness in diabetic patients. Benfotiamine (a bioavailable B1 form) and methylcobalamin B12 also have strong evidence for diabetic neuropathy support. These work best alongside proper blood sugar management.
Is magnesium good for nerve pain?
Magnesium is essential for nerve signal transmission, and deficiency can cause or worsen tingling, numbness, and pain. Magnesium glycinate is the preferred form for nerve support because of its high absorption and calming effect on the nervous system. Correcting a deficiency can significantly reduce neuropathic symptoms.
Can too much B6 cause nerve damage?
Yes. While B6 is important for nerve health at moderate doses (10-25mg daily), chronically high doses (above 200mg daily) can actually cause peripheral neuropathy. Look for supplements that provide B6 within the safe range and avoid stacking multiple B6-containing products.
Should I take nerve supplements with food?
Most nerve supplements are best absorbed with food, particularly those containing fat-soluble ingredients like alpha-lipoic acid and benfotiamine. B12 liquid drops can be taken sublingually on an empty stomach for maximum absorption. Magnesium is generally well-tolerated with or without food, though taking it with meals may reduce any digestive discomfort.
